Summary
Franklin learns that winning isn't everything when a game of tag turns competitive, then discovers that a new pet needs steady care every single day. Two gentle stories about playing fair and taking responsibility.

Discussion questions
Discussion
These stories are about good sportsmanship and looking after a pet.
- Why did Franklin's friends stop having fun during the game?
- What does a pet need every day to stay healthy?
- When have you had to take turns or follow the rules of a game?
Quick work-a-long
Vocabulary: fair, turns, responsibility.
Try it: Draw a pet you would care for and list two jobs you would do for it each day.
